For most, "356" is synonymous with the , the car that launched a global legend in 1948. Born from Ferry Porsche’s desire for a small, agile sports car that didn't yet exist, it was famously built because he couldn't find his dream car elsewhere. The Evolution of a Legend

The 356 was produced from 1948 to 1965, with approximately 78,000 units built. Its evolution is typically broken down into four major generations:
